When film was first invented, it was "moving picture." That explains why film began to build its identity in action. No doubt action has been one of the materials that it never ceases to love from the beginning of the history till this day. In the 1950s when color film was getting popular with the public, film makers wanted to accentuate colors on the screen, so it was these genres the film industry turned to: period drama, musical and animation. An action film, set in the French Revolution Era, Scaramouch, thus is one of the feature films that will show the changes in the film industry at the time.
